Tasks
-
Physical connectivity is implemented between the two Layer 2 switches, and the network connectivity between them must be configured.
1. Configure an LACP EtherChannel and number it as 44; configure it between switches SW1 and SW2 using interfaces Ethemet0/0 and Ethernet0/1 on both sides. The LACP mode must match on both ends.
2. Configure the EtherChannel as a trunk link.
3. Configure the trunk link with 802.1q tags.
4. Configure VLAN 'MONITORING' as the untagged VLAN of the EtherChannel.
